Output 5abfbfe338d1949e3b3524b8671493042a70129faa719e1e25bef995217f6b14:2

value
22358038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 349f4e53bdf19233de3390bf7e32c9e9506d88d7 OP_EQUALVERIFY OP_CHECKSIG
address
15oEykNG9zvet4JjWmy4pHW2f3mo5K9jVz
transaction
5abfbfe338d1949e3b3524b8671493042a70129faa719e1e25bef995217f6b14
confirmations
272865
spent
true